We will have special gifts from our sponsors to give out.<\/p><\/div><\/div><\/div><\/div><\/div><\/div><\/div><\/div><\/div><\/div><\/div><\/div><div class=\"nt_clearfix\"><\/div><div class=\"agro-section-wrapper\"><div class=\"nt-column\"><div class=\"nt-shortcode-wrapper \"><div class=\"section section--no-pb jarallax item_6a1ac1e771f24 vc_custom_1726499495440\" data-speed=\"0.4\" data-img-position=\"50% 65%\" data-res-css=\"        \"><div class=\"container\"><div class=\"simple-text-block simple-text-block--no-pb\"><div class=\"row justify-content-md-center\"><div class=\"col-12 col-md-11\"><div class=\"row justify-content-lg-between no-gutters\"><div class=\"col-12 col-lg-5\"><img decoding=\"async\" src=\"https:\/\/www.grainplacefoundation.org\/wp-content\/uploads\/2024\/02\/AmberSciligo.jpg\" class=\"img-fluid\" alt=\"AmberSciligo.jpg\"><\/div><div class=\"col-12 my-3 d-lg-none\"><\/div><div class=\"col-12 col-lg-6\"><div class=\"js-slick slick_6a1ac1e771f27\" data-slick='{\"autoplay\": false, \"arrows\": false, \"dots\": false, \"pauseOnHover\": false, \"speed\": 1000}'><div class=\"__item\"><h3>Amber Sciligo <span>, Ph.D. <\/span><\/h3><p>Dr. Amber Sciligo is the director of science programs at The Organic Center where she directs projects associated with communicating and conducting research related to organic agriculture. During her tenure at The Organic Center, Dr. Sciligo has worked closely with researchers, industry, farmers, and policymakers to identify organic research needs, and she has collaborated on a diverse range of research programs with her most recent collaborations including projects aimed at:<\/p>\n<p>- Mitigating climate change<\/p>\n<p>- Increasing the accessibility of equitable agricultural technology aimed at supporting the organic supply chain<\/p>\n<p>- Reducing incongruities in National Organic Program standards and third party food safety requirements<\/p>\n<p>- Tackling challenges associated with inadvertent pesticide contamination across the organic supply chain<\/p>\n<p>- Incorporating livestock into vegetable cropping systems  <\/p>\n<p>Dr. Sciligo heads The Organic Center\u2019s grant writing program and FFAR funding partnership which offers organic research funding and prizes for outstanding organic extension efforts. She also leads the center\u2019s signature conference event, Organic Confluences, which brings together policy makers, researchers, farmers, industry members, and other non-profits to address and overcome challenges faced by the organic sector. Dr. Sciligo brings the organic voice to communities at international, national, and local levels by serving on boards and advisory committees for ISOFAR, FFAR and the Organic Association of Kentucky, the state in which she resides.<\/p>\n<p>Dr. Sciligo received her PhD at Lincoln University, New Zealand in ecology and evolution with a specialty in plant\/insect interactions, specifically pollination services to plants. Her extensive postdoctoral work at UC Berkeley included several interdisciplinary projects related to  the impacts of farm diversification within the organic system on a range of ecosystem services from biodiversity, pollination, natural pest control,  soil health, and climate change mitigation, as well as the livelihoods of farmers. During my tenure I have traveled to 48 of the 50 United States, China and the Philippines, focusing my efforts towards educating\/motivating the youth and community leaders to embrace culture and tradition.\u201d\n<\/p><\/blockquote>\n<p>During his career, Anthony L Warrior has worked for 15 Tribal nations in healthcare, a residential home for children, and Casino\/Resorts. In his teenage years he traveled and spoke on behalf of the United National Indian Tribal Youth program.<\/p>\n<p>His experiences working for tribal nations have included studying and acquiring local traditional recipes, stories, and historical methods in food preparation and preservation. His approach to cultural nutrition is interconnected with feeding the mental, spiritual, and holistic balance necessary to differentiate the total health needs of each individual tribal group. His lifelong quest for education fuels the passion for learning and preparing traditional sustenance that stimulates cultural retention and community healing.<\/p>\n<hr class=\"wp-block-separator has-alpha-channel-opacity\" \/>\n\n\t\t<\/div>\n\t<\/div>\n<div class=\"vc_btn3-container vc_btn3-center\" ><a onmouseleave=\"this.style.borderColor='#3f3f3f'; this.style.backgroundColor='transparent'; this.style.color='#3f3f3f'\" onmouseenter=\"this.style.borderColor='#fcdb5a'; this.style.backgroundColor='#fcdb5a'; this.style.color='#3f3f3f';\" style=\"border-color:#3f3f3f; color:#3f3f3f;\" class=\"vc_general vc_btn3 vc_btn3-size-lg vc_btn3-shape-rounded vc_btn3-style-outline-custom\" href=\"https:\/\/www.facebook.com\/WarriorsPalate\" title=\"Find Out More\">Find Out More<\/a><\/div><\/div><\/div><\/div><div class=\"nt-column col-sm-2\"><div class=\"nt-column-inner  \"><div class=\"nt-wrapper\"><\/div><\/div><\/div><\/div><\/div><\/div><\/div><div class=\"nt_clearfix\"><\/div><div class=\"agro-section-wrapper\"><div class=\"nt-column\"><div class=\"nt-shortcode-wrapper \"><div class=\"section  section_6a1ac1e775646 vc_custom_1708621971495\" data-res-css=\"   .section.section_6a1ac1e775646 .section-heading .__title {color: #000000; } .section.section_6a1ac1e775646 .section-heading .__title span{color: #000000; } \"><div class=\"container\"><div class=\"section-heading section-heading--center\" data-aos=\"fade\"><h2 class=\"__title\">Become A <span>Sponsor<\/span><\/h2><p>We are currently seeking additional Sponsors for Field Day 2024.
